PENGARUH PRODUK RESTORAN TERHADAP KEPUASAN PELANGGAN (STUDY WISATA KULINER RESTORAN BUMBU DESA KOTA BANDUNG) Utomo, Bambang Sapto

Abstract

Berdasarkan data dari Badan Pusat Statistik Jawa Barat tahun 2012 tentang Pertumbuhan Jumlah pertumbuhan jumlah restoran di Bandung dari 50,46 % restoran pada tahun 2010, menjadi 8,06 % pada tahun 2012. Hal ini memicu asumsi peneliti telah terjadi penurunan volume penjualan dari lokus yang diteliti , diperoleh data bahwa penjualan produk  di Restoran Bumbu Desa Bandung bulan Nov 2010 – Nov 2012 banyak yang tidak memenuhi target.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k mengetahui pengaruh produk terhadap kepuasan konsumen pada Produk Restoran Bumbu Desa Bandung.  Metode yang digunakan dalam penelitian ini adalah kuantitatif deskriftif. Dengan menetapkan 2 (dua) variabel, yaitu  Produk (X) dan Kepuasan Pelanggan (Y).Dengan melihat pada perhitungan koefisien korelasi antara variabel produk terhadap variabel kepuasan pelanggan diketahui bahwa terdapat hubungan yang sangat kuat antara produk terhadap kepuasan pelanggan. Berdasarkan hasil perhitungan koefisien determinasi diketahui bahwa secara bersama-sama faktor produk inti, produk formal dan produk yang ditingkatkan berpengaruh terhadap kepuasan pelanggan sebesar 57,2%.   Sedangkan dari korelasi secara parsial atau individu diketahui bahwa faktor produk inti berpengaruh terhadap kepuasan pelanggan sebesar 14,4% terhadap kepuasan pelanggan, apabila sub variabel produk formal dan produk yang ditingkatkan  dianggap konstan. Sedangkan bila yang dianggap konstan adalah produk yang ditingkatkan dan produk inti, maka sub variabel produk formal mempengaruhi sebesar 49,1% terhadap kepuasan pelanggan yang terakhir adalah  produk inti sebesar 43,0% terhadap kepuasan pelanggan. Kata Kunci: Produk  dan Kepuasan Konsumen
Pengaruh Komunikasi, Motivasi Kerja Dan Kompetensi Terhadap Kepuasan Kerja Serta Implikasinya Pada Kinerja Dosen Pada Perguruan Tinggi Pariwisata Swasta Di Jawa Barat Riyadi, Heru; Utomo, Bambang Sapto; Masatip, Anwari

Abstract

The background to this research is based upon the phenomenon that is where lectures performances is not optimal so that the students' quality not favorable. As for the main factor, is the despicable performance of lecturer job satisfaction is low. Based on the previous researches, low job satisfaction is often caused by non-optimal of communication, work motivation and competences of lecturers at the private tourism college in west java. This study aims to acknowledge and analyze the impact of communication, work motivation and competences on job satisfaction and its implication on lecturers' performance in West Java private tourism college. This study uses a descriptive and explanatory survey approach. In this study, the samples were 224 lecturers in west java private colleges. The research used path analysis to interpret and explain the data result. The research concludes that there is an influence of the communication on job satisfaction of 3, 6%. Furthermore, the effect of work motivation on job satisfaction was 20, 3% and the effect of competences on job satisfaction were 12, 9%. In overall, the influence of independent variables on the job satisfaction was 70%, while the remaining 30% was from the other factors which were not examined for this research.
Potensi Dark Tourism Pasca Bencana di Kawasan Ekonomi Khusus Tanjung Lesung, Provinsi Banten Kalsum , ER. Ummi; Faisal, Faisal; Arifin, Djauhar; Utomo, Bambang Sapto; Noerdjmal, Daeng

Abstract

On December 23, 2018, a tsunami caused by the eruption of Mount Anak Krakatau in the Sunda Strait hit the coastal areas of Banten and Lampung. There were at least 426 people killed and 7,202 injured and 23 people missing due to this incident. One of the areas affected by this disaster is the Special Economic Zone (KEK) of Tanjung Lesung Tourism, which was officially opened in February 2015. With this incident, the Tourism sector in the area needs to be considered starting from the development and post-disaster plans. This research was conducted to be able to map out how the potential of new tourism due to disasters that can be used as a plan to develop tourist attractions in the region. This research was conducted qualitatively by involving various key informants as sources of data needed such as the head of the Local Tourism Office, coastal community leaders affected by the disaster, affected communities, hotel owners around the disaster area. From the results of these data and used as a source of information to be used as a result of research. The results of this study are how a new potential emerges utilizing the areas of the former disaster and the mystery stories of the disaster.
Pengembangan Potensi Desa Wisata Melalui 3A Dan Penerapan CHSE Di Desa Cihanjawar, Kabupaten Purwakarta Dalam Masa Adaptasi Kebiasaan Baru ER. Ummi Kalsum; Djauhar Arifin; Marsianus Raga; Daeng Noerdjamal; Bambang Sapto Utomo

Abstract

The Covid-19 pandemic has had a broad impact on the global tourism world since the end of 2019. Data shows that international tourist arrivals declined sharply in the first half of 2020 (-65%) compared to 2019. The strategy has been implemented by various special countries, the Indonesian Ministry of Tourism proclaimed the principle of Adapting to New Habits (AKB) in the Indonesian tourism industry as an integral part of the permit to reopen tourism businesses and destinations. The IMR principles in Indonesian tourism are applied from a strategic and technical perspective as well as from supply chain changes to the needs and demands of the management of tourists. This research was produced to be able to see the readiness of tourist destinations in the region, especially Tourism Villages in dealing with the Covid-19 situation and conditions with several strategies that have been set by the central government starting from CHSE and digitalization for Tourism Villages. This study used a quantitative research method with a description that describes each goal starting from the 3A condition, the Health Protocol, and its digitization. This mapping is very important to determine the direction of the potential development of Cihanjawar Tourism Village as a tourist destination
